Have you seen the beautiful wallpaper featured on the back panels in our "At Home with Arts and Crafts" exhibition? All of the wallpaper was hand-printed by Bradbury & Bradbury Art Wallpapers. Founded in 1979 by Bruce Bradbury, the company first began reproducing and reinterpreting historic patterns for Victorian era interiors. In the early 1990s, after a decade of research on original bungalow interiors, Bradbury & Bradbury released their first collection of designs for the Arts and Crafts revival, intended for historic properties built between 1900 and 1920. All of their art wallpapers are hand silkscreened in their Benicia, California, studio.
